AutoNation – “Don't Expect Bankers Hours.

Jun 22, 2009

3.0

AutoNation Sales Manager Autonation in Fort Lauderdale, FL:   (Current Employee)

Pros

Autonation is a process driven company. Follow the process while employed and you will gain a whole lot of knowledge and you will truly become a quality seasoned Sales Professional.

Cons

The Company does not adjust store hours to allow employees to have a better quality of life. The hours are long and not necessary. Managers are worked hard and are accountable for more and more responsibilities and are not salaried. Your pay is based on sales performance so you tend to make less and less money every pay period in a tough economy.

Advice to Senior Management

Have your HR Department and Market Presidents put together a company survey for employees in order to see how Autonation can become a better employer. During a tough economy many of the Sales Associates, Sales Managers, Office Personel, Service Writers, Service Managers and Techs that are left are the best of the best. You know this becuase they were seleted in many cases to stay with the company and not laid off during a tough economy. These are your core employees and it would be nice to compensate them a little more as things improve with time. Many of their complaints are similar go out and find out. Listen to them, because they are talking.
